YesJapan Teacher (Yuki) Post Date: 2004-04-28 12:47:56 : member since 2004 Mar 26 Questions: 0 Comments: 298: The polite way of saying "What are you saying" is なにを いっていますか? There are 2 formal ways to say goodbye in Japanese. The first way to say goodbye is さようなら (sayounara). This is the most common formal expression to bid someone goodbye.
